Police are appealing for information on a robbery which took place at a house in Jervaulx Crescent, Manningham, Bradford.
It happened at about 7.30pm on March 30, when three men entered the home of a 55-year-old man and took a laptop computer.
Detective Inspector Ryan Bragg, of Bradford CID, said: “Thankfully, the victim was uninjured during the incident, but was extremely shaken by the experience.
“The three men are described as being in their late teens or early twenties, of slim build and between 5’8” and 5’10” tall.
“The individual who took the laptop has a distinctive thin moustache and curly hair. The laptop was a Samsung model with damage to the right-hand hinge cover. I am particularly interested in hearing from anyone who has recently been approached by anyone to sell such an item.”
